Effectiveness of the holistic primary school-based intervention MindMatters: study protocol for a cluster-randomised controlled trial

This study will contribute to strengthen the evidence base for holistic school (mental) health promotion interventions using a study design with high internal validity. Based on an intervention model, the results will not only provide insights into the relationship between proximal and distal outcomes, but will also allow conclusions to be drawn about how the implementation of the intervention affects its effectiveness. Finally, the findings also address the question of whether improved mental health has a positive effect on primary school pupils ’ academic performance.Trial registrationGerman Clinical Trials Register DRKS00023762.
